Hi,

are you able to reproduce your issue without Kubernetes layer on Artemis 
instances? I’m not sure how exactly do you kill a pod, but 40 second timeout 
very much looks like default pod grace timeout + 10 seconds.

Subject: HA failover: Nothing we try reduces client recovery below one minute

Greetings!

We are having a devil of a time trying to reduce delay during a failover event. 
 We’ve set our URL to
(tcp://dm-activemq-live-svc:61616,tcp://dm-activemq-backup-svc:61617)?ha=true&reconnectAttempts=200&initialConnectAttempts=200&clientFailureCheckPeriod=10000&connectionTTL=10000&callTimeout=10000

But nothing seems to reduce the time it takes for a sender to detect the issue 
and failover.  With or without these parameters, it takes a full minute to 
recover after failover. Are there other parameters to adjust?  Something in the 
broker?  Is there some internal retry loop and timer that waits longer that we 
can influence?

We are testing failover by killing one of the AMQ pods.  This almost always 
succeeds without issue, except occasionally it doesn’t.

The backup broker log shows that it assumes control very quickly

But then it takes 40 seconds for the “10000ms” timeout to happen.
2024-02-16T22:43:35.988 [http-nio-9910-exec-9] JmsProducerPool.send_:376 
[9v2zwvclclrc] WARN - Error sending message, will retry javax.jms.JMSException: 
AMQ219014: Timed out after waiting 10000 ms for response when sending packet 71

Our problem is really that this 40-second delay seems to push everything back 
so that recovery takes over a minute.  Once we get into the one-minute mark, we 
start hitting several timeouts, like our own RPC timeout setting and the nginx 
ingress controller for K8S.  How can we know why this takes so long?  We’ve set 
every timeout we can find for the AMQ client to 10 seconds.  Is there some 
other setting we need to adjust?
